In a recent statement, JPMorgan Chase CEO Jamie Dimon indicated that the bank is prepared to pursue a significant acquisition, potentially spending as much as $20 billion. “We are on the lookout,” Dimon said, without specifying a target sector or company. Such a transaction would be among the largest in JPMorgan’s history, comparable to its 2008 acquisition of Bear Stearns and the purchase of Washington Mutual later that year. Analysts note that the size and scope of any deal could invite increased regulatory attention, given JPMorgan’s dominant market position. The bank currently holds over $3.9 trillion in assets, making it the largest U.S. bank by that measure. Any acquisition in the $20 billion range would likely require approval from the Federal Reserve and other regulators, who have recently signaled a tougher stance on large bank mergers. Key takeaways from Dimon’s comments include the bank’s continued appetite for strategic growth through M&A. Historically, JPMorgan has used acquisitions to expand into new business lines, such as its 2021 purchase of open banking platform Finicity. While Dimon did not name potential targets, industry observers suggest areas like payments, wealth management, or fintech could be logical fits. Regulatory scrutiny remains a major factor: the Biden administration has proposed stricter merger guidelines for big banks, and any $20 billion deal would likely face a lengthy review process. Additionally, JPMorgan’s massive balance sheet means even a large acquisition would be easily digestible from a capital perspective, but the integration risk and cultural fit would be key considerations. Dimon’s comments come as the bank continues to post strong earnings, with its shares trading near record levels on normal trading volume. For investors, Dimon’s openness to a major acquisition signals that the bank is actively seeking growth opportunities beyond organic expansion. However, potential deals could bring both opportunities and risks. A well-targeted acquisition might strengthen JPMorgan’s competitive advantages in certain segments, such as consumer banking or technology. Conversely, regulatory pushback or a poorly integrated deal could weigh on returns. The $20 billion figure, while large, represents only a small fraction of JPMorgan’s market capitalization, suggesting the bank has ample firepower. Market participants will likely watch for any further details on timing or sector focus. Broader implications for the banking sector may include increased M&A activity if JPMorgan moves forward, potentially prompting competitors to seek similar deals.
